Pre-State 2014
This Saturday the ONW gymnastics team is competing for the
state championship at Shawnee Mission West. The team is ranked third in their
league and has high hopes for this coming meet.
The team is lead by Juniors Jessie Payne and Carly Stroup.
Both gymnasts coming out strong and pulling through this last stretch of the
season despite injuries.
Payne is hoping to duplicate her last season, state
individual championship. She’s been strong on bars and vault all season long
and is hoping that those two events can lead her to victory.
The team however cannot survive just on these two girls,
however, Senior Carissa Winters and Freshman Emily Copeland are both preparing
to come out strong and preform magnificently to get their team to a high
finish.
The teams biggest threat right now is OE, their team has
almost twenty girls on it giving them an advantage over the ONW ravens who only
have four athletes.
